### Step 2 — Move template cache to the shared store

After upgrading Pagewright to 3.1, rendered template fragments are cached centrally instead of per-node, which eliminates the cold-render spikes customers reported. Verify the cache warmer completed by checking the admin dashboard's "fragments cached" counter. The warmer pulls template definitions from the rendering database using the connection string below.

primary connection of yagep-kahip = redis://giliel_svc:zYiKsLL2PLpfPL@db-348f.xolmarsys.corp:5432/fenwyn

**Vendor Note: Thornvale DB — Query Planner Regression**

For support awareness: the latest Thornvale database release introduced a query planner regression affecting joins on partitioned tables. Customers on version 4.2 may report slow dashboard loads. Workaround: advise them to pin to 4.1 until the vendor patch ships, expected within two weeks. Do not suggest manual planner hints; the vendor voids support if those are applied. Report affected customer cases to the address below.

billing contact of haduf-hahap = belion_quenwyn_feneth@orvexgrid.test

Runbook 7.3 — TimeGrid solver account recovery. If the scheduler admin account for the Hartvale deployment is locked out, verify the requester against the on-call roster, record the incident number, and only then proceed. Restore access via the offline recovery console, which prompts once. Enter, exactly as written, the recovery passphrase shown here:

unlock words, fahog-yahof: belael-holael-eliius-joreth-tamax-olimir-norwyn-holwyn-fraath-lamius-norwyn-druys-soriel

# Break-Glass: Catalog Cache Invalidation

Scope: the Pinrow product catalog at Veldstone Retail. If stale prices persist after a purge and the Hollowmere invalidation queue is wedged, use break-glass to flush the edge tier directly. Contractors: get verbal sign-off from the catalog lead first. Steps: open the Hollowmere admin shell, select emergency-flush, confirm the tenant, and run it once — repeated flushes thrash the origin. Access is logged and expires after 20 minutes. Unseal the admin shell with the passphrase below.

recovery phrase for kahop-tajog: istix-casvan